c) Cashless Exercise. If at any time after one year from the date of
issuance of this Warrant there is no effective Registration Statement
registering the resale of the Warrant Shares by the Holder, then this
Warrant may also be exercised at such time by means of a "cashless
exercise" in which the Holder shall be entitled to receive a certificate
for the number of Warrant Shares equal to the quotient obtained by
dividing [(A-B) (X)] by (A), where:
(A) = the VWAP on the Trading Day immediately preceding
the date of such election;
(B) = the Exercise Price of this Warrant, as adjusted;
and
(X) = the number of Warrant Shares issuable upon
exercise of this Warrant in accordance with the
terms of this Warrant by means of a cash exercise
rather than a cashless exercise.

v. Buy-In Compensation. In addition to any other rights
available to the Holder, if the Company fails to cause its transfer
agent to transmit to the Holder through the DWAC system a
certificate or certificates representing the Warrant Shares pursuant
to an exercise on or before the Warrant Share Delivery Date, and if
after such date the Holder is required by its broker to purchase (in
an open market transaction or otherwise) shares of Common Stock to
deliver in satisfaction of a sale by the Holder of the Warrant
Shares which the Holder anticipated receiving upon such exercise (a
"Buy-In"), then the Company shall (1) pay in cash to the Holder the
amount by which (x) the Holder's total purchase price (including
brokerage commissions, if any) for the shares of Common Stock so
purchased exceeds (y) the amount obtained by multiplying (A) the
number of Warrant Shares that the Company was required to deliver to
the Holder in connection with the exercise at issue times (B) the
price at which the sell order giving rise to such purchase
obligation was executed, and (2) at the option of the Holder, either
reinstate the portion of the Warrant and equivalent number of
Warrant Shares for which such exercise was not honored or deliver to
the Holder the number of shares of Common Stock that would have been
issued had the Company timely complied with its exercise and
delivery obligations hereunder. For example, if the Holder purchases
Common Stock having a total purchase price of $11,000 to cover a
Buy-In with respect to an attempted exercise of shares of Common
Stock with an aggregate sale price giving rise to such purchase
obligation of $10,000, under clause (1) of the immediately preceding
sentence the Company shall be required to pay the Holder $1,000. The
Holder shall provide the Company written notice indicating the
amounts payable to the Holder in respect of the Buy-In, together
with applicable confirmations and other evidence reasonably
requested by the Company. Nothing herein shall limit a Holder's
right to pursue any other remedies available to it hereunder, at law
or in equity including, without limitation, a decree of specific
performance and/or injunctive relief with respect to the Company's
failure to timely deliver certificates representing shares of Common
Stock upon exercise of the Warrant as required pursuant to the terms
hereof.

Section 3. Certain Adjustments.
a) Stock Dividends and Splits. If the Company, at any time while
this Warrant is outstanding: (A) pays a stock dividend or otherwise make a
distribution or distributions on shares of its Common Stock or any other
equity or equity equivalent securities payable in shares of Common Stock
(which, for avoidance of doubt, shall not include any shares of Common
Stock issued by the Company pursuant to this Warrant), (B) subdivides
outstanding shares of Common Stock into a larger number of shares, (C)
combines (including by way of reverse stock split) outstanding shares of
Common Stock into a smaller number of shares, or (D) issues by
reclassification of shares of the Common Stock any shares of capital stock
of the Company, then in each case the Exercise Price shall be multiplied
by a fraction of which the numerator shall be the number of shares of
Common Stock (excluding treasury shares, if any) outstanding before such
event and of which the denominator shall be the number of shares of Common
Stock outstanding after such event and the number of Warrant Shares
issuable upon exercise of this Warrant shall be proportionately adjusted.
Any adjustment made pursuant to this Section 3(a) shall become effective
immediately after the record date for the determination of stockholders
entitled to receive such dividend or distribution and shall become
effective immediately after the effective date in the case of a
subdivision, combination or re-classification.

f) Fundamental Transaction. If, at any time while this Warrant is
outstanding, (A) the Company effects any merger or consolidation of the
Company with or into another Person, in which the Company is not the
surviving entity, or the Company's then existing shareholders will own
less than 51% of the surviving entity, (B) the Company effects any sale of
all or substantially all of its assets in one or a series of related
transactions, (C) any tender offer or exchange offer (whether by the
Company or another Person) is completed pursuant to which holders of
Common Stock are permitted to tender or exchange their shares for other
securities, cash or property, or (D) the Company effects any
reclassification of the Common Stock or any compulsory share exchange
pursuant to which the Common Stock is effectively converted into or
exchanged for other securities, cash or property (in any such case, a
"Fundamental Transaction"), then, upon any subsequent conversion of this
Warrant, the Holder shall have the right to receive, for each Warrant
Share that would have been issuable upon such exercise absent such
Fundamental Transaction, at the option of the Holder, (a) upon exercise of
this Warrant, the number of shares of Common Stock of the successor or
acquiring corporation or of the Company, if it is the surviving
corporation, and Alternate Consideration receivable upon or as a result of
such reorganization, reclassification, merger, consolidation or
disposition of assets by a Holder of the number of shares of Common Stock
for which this Warrant is exercisable immediately prior to such event or
(b) only in the event the Company is acquired in an all cash acquisition,
cash equal to the value of this Warrant as determined in accordance with
the Black-Scholes option pricing formula (the "Alternate Consideration").
For purposes of any such exercise, the determination of the Exercise Price
shall be appropriately adjusted to apply to such Alternate Consideration
based on the amount of Alternate Consideration issuable in respect of one
share of Common Stock in such Fundamental Transaction, and the Company
shall apportion the Exercise Price among the Alternate Consideration in a
reasonable manner reflecting the relative value of any different
components of the Alternate Consideration. If holders of Common Stock are
given any choice as to the securities, cash or property to be received in
a Fundamental Transaction, then the Holder shall be given the same choice
as to the Alternate Consideration it receives upon any exercise of this
Warrant following such Fundamental Transaction. To the extent necessary to
effectuate the foregoing provisions, any successor to the Company or
surviving entity in such Fundamental Transaction shall issue to the Holder
a new warrant consistent with the foregoing provisions and evidencing the
Holder's right to exercise such warrant into Alternate Consideration upon
the payment thereof. The terms of any agreement pursuant to which a
Fundamental Transaction is effected shall include terms requiring any such
successor or surviving entity to comply with the provisions of this
paragraph (f) and insuring that this Warrant (or any such replacement
security) will be similarly adjusted upon any subsequent transaction
analogous to a Fundamental Transaction.
